NEW: A DHS "self-deportation" contract worth up to ~$1 billion was "unlawful, rushed, and noncompetitive," per a lawsuit. It went to a firm w/ no prior fed contracts whose CEO earlier worked w/ a top DHS official involved in the award

www.pogo.org/investigatio...
Massive DHS "Self-Deportation" Contract Challenged as Secretive and…
The “rushed” deal worth up to $915 million was handed to a firm with “no track record” as a federal contractor, a rival's lawsuit alleges.

NEW! A top White House official has a $2 million to $10 million stake in Palantir. That official's office is playing a key role in the gargantuan Golden Dome missile defense program, which Palantir is seen as likely to benefit from - more @pogo.org

www.pogo.org/investigatio...
Gold Rush: Top Trump Officials’ Silicon Valley Ties
The Golden Dome missile defense project could be a “slush fund” for tech companies like Palantir — and for high-level officials with financial stakes.

An update! The Air Force has now announced $53 million in planned barracks improvements at Andersen AFB following our coverage of the poor conditions service members are living in there.
I think it’s worth noting that the same dire barracks conditions that prompted the Navy Secretary to evacuate sailors and Marines did not elicit the same response from the Air Force: 430 airmen and soldiers continue to live in these barracks.

www.pogo.org/investigatio...
Navy Secretary "Appalled" by Barracks Conditions in Guam
Newly obtained photos reveal the “clearly neglected” conditions inside Guam barracks that prompted an uproar by Navy officials.

Incredible investigation by my colleagues @ziembavision.bsky.social and Julienne McClure analyzing publicly available CBP data to show, despite rhetoric from politicians trying to create a link between migration and a drug crisis, that only 11 people out of 5.8 million were caught carrying fentanyl.
Out of the 5.8 million migrants stopped by Border Patrol during a three year period, only 11 were caught carrying fentanyl.

Our new investigation for @pogo.org shows just how INCREDIBLY RARE it is for migrants to bring drugs across the border.

www.pogo.org/investigatio...
Migrant Drug Seizures by Border Patrol Incredibly Rare, Data Shows
Despite political rhetoric suggesting migrants are fueling drug seizures, a detailed review shows just how infrequently Border Patrol agents seize drugs from migrants.
